Purrloin, the Devious Pokémon, is a Dark-type Pokémon introduced in Generation V, hailing from the Unova region. It evolves into Liepard starting at level 20. Known for its mischievous and cunning nature, Purrloin delights in stealing from people, not out of malice but purely to amuse itself by witnessing their frustration. This behavior is deeply ingrained in its Pokédex lore, highlighting its playful yet vexing personality. In the games, Purrloin often appears in early routes, establishing itself as a common but memorable encounter. Its sleek, feline appearance and distinctive purple and black coloration make it visually striking. In the anime, Purrloin has been featured in various episodes, often showcasing its thieving antics and charming demeanor, further cementing its role as a beloved, if sometimes troublesome, character. Its Dark typing gives it an advantage against Psychic and Ghost types, while making it vulnerable to Fighting, Bug, and Fairy moves. Purrloin's design and character arc contribute to its cultural significance as a representation of playful tricksters within the Pokémon world.
